Facilities Ticket — Mail Room Relocation

The mail room at Harlowe House is moving from Ground Floor East to Basement Level 1 on Thursday. Reception should redirect couriers to the B1 loading corridor from 08:00. Parcel lockers will be offline during the move. To open the B1 corridor door for couriers, use the temporary pass code below.

staff pass of haweg-bafop = bdg-G-69

Leadership Review Briefing — Large-Deal Discount Policy

For the finance team's consideration: Varnello Systems' current discount framework permits up to 18% on contracts exceeding the large-deal threshold, subject to dual approval from regional finance and the pricing desk. Analysis of the last six quarters shows margin erosion concentrated in the Kestrel product line, where discounts averaged 22% after exceptions. We propose tightening exception authority and adding a quarterly audit. The strategic rationale follows below.

confidential, kagup-bafog: Fraaxax Group is in early talks to buy Soroxox Group for about $343.8 million. The Olidor launch date is June 14, and nothing goes to the press before then. Legal wants the Aldmirek Logistics term sheet signed before July 23.

Quarterly Planning Note — Divestiture of the Coastal Tooling Unit

For the finance team: the sale of the Coastal Tooling unit to Pellmark Industries remains on track for close in Q3. Please finalize the carve-out balance sheet, reconcile intercompany positions, and prepare the working-capital adjustment schedule by month-end. Audit support requests should be prioritized. For planning purposes, note the following sensitive item:

internal memo for hawef-kahif: The finance team signed off on a budget of $25.9 million for Project Sorox. The renewal with Pelokek Logistics closes at $51.7 million a year, 52 percent below the last contract.

UserSplit Cutover Drift: the extracted account service and the legacy Marigold monolith user module are reporting divergent record counts during dual-write. This fires when drift exceeds 0.5% over 15 minutes. New team members should not replay writes manually. Reconciliation steps and the rollback procedure are documented on the internal page.

wiki page, tajog-fafog: https://gitlab.paliqsys.corp/dash/display/job/853dd6fcbf54